Assembling a Stack

You can stack PowerConnect 6200 series switches up to 12 switches high, supporting up to 576 front panel ports.
Create a stack by connecting adjacent units using the stacking ports on the left side of the switch rear. See
Figure 1-3.
NOTE:
The switches must be turned off as they are added to a stack.
Install a separately purchased stacking module in rear "Bay 1" in each of the switches to be stacked.
1
Use the cables supplied with the stacking modules to connect from one switch to the next until all switches
2
are connected in a ring.
Make sure that the last stacking cable is connected from the last switch to the first switch to create a loop.
3
If necessary, use a separately purchased three-meter stacking cable to connect the switches.
